#d1b838 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d1b838 is composed of 82% red, 72.2%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12% magenta, 73.2%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 50.2 degrees, a saturation of 62.4% and a lightness of 52%. #d1b838 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ff70 with #a37100.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#d1b838 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d1b838 has RGB values of R:209, G:184,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.12, Y:0.73,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13744184.
